There's a major Google algorithm update happening, destroying news publishers.

Google is tightlipped though, not confirming anything.

This one site owner said, "Since yesterday, traffic is in a free fall. User engagement: 0. Zombies: 100%. Bots: up again."

Another, "The downward swings are just so wild that you just lose complete hope in what you are doing. The recalibration, or as we used to say in the earlier days, Google Dance, has started once again.

The Google volatility trackers are off the charts:

9.3/10 Google algorithm volatility, meaning results are dropping, then rising nonstop. It's a Googlequake.

The people feeling this the most are going after informational keywords like who, what, when, why, how keywords. They often depend on ad revenue, putting them in a bad position.

Easy way to diversify is to vibe code an app in your niche, put it on a subdomain, target use-intent keywords.

Bottom of funnel keywords have way less volatility.
